Daniel Isn't Talking by Marti Leimbach

Melanie Marsh is an American living in London with her British husband, Stephen, and their two young children. The Marshes' orderly home life is shattered when their son Daniel is given a devastating diagnosis. Resourceful and determined not to acceptt what others, including her husband, say is inevitable, Melanie finds an ally in the idealistic Andy, whose unorthodox ideas may just prove that Daniel is far more normal than anyone imagined. Daniel Isn't Talking is a moving story of a family in crisis, told with warmth, compassion, and humor.
Leimbach, Marti: -

Marti Leimbach is a fiction writer and a core tutor at Oxford University's creative writing program; she is best known for her international bestseller, Dying Young, which was made into a major motion picture. She is also the author of The Man from Saigon and Daniel Isn't Talking, among other novels. Dragonfly Girl is her first YA novel. www.martileimbach.com
